Valentine’s Day Dinner

Of course, its the life of a chef, that I’m never home to spend time with my wife for Valentine’s Day.  This year, I decided to surprise her with dinner the day after.

I made Bacon-Wrapped Colossal Shrimp, stuffed with a thin slice of Jalepeno for some kick.

bacon wrapped shrimp

I couldn’t help myself with the “Day After Valentine’s Day” sale at the grocery store & picked up the Lobster.  It is topped with a garlic butter sauce, and presented beautifully.

Originally, I had planned to serve the shrimp with Steel-Head Trout. So I went ahead and prepared it.

steel head trout

The trout is topped with a Tropical salsa consisting of Tomato, Avacado, Mango & Kiwi.

On the side, fresh steamed broccoli & white rice.

lobster and garlic butter sauce

For desert, we picked up some chocolate-covered strawberries dipped in coconut, oreos, peanut butter & cinnoman. Unfortunately, I don’t have any pictures of those, because we ate them all!
